Health Environmentalist

The Bourbon County Health Department is seeking a Health Environmentalist for a full-time (37.5 hours/week) contract position with benefits. This position is intended to provide ongoing support to the department’s public health environmental and emergency preparedness programs. The role is designed to be sustainable over the long term and is supported by a secure funding source and satisfactory performance.

General Duties include:

  • Inspect food establishments for compliance with state regulations pertaining to sanitation. Performs regular inspections of hotels/motel, schools, swimming pools, mobile home parks, tattoo studios to ensure compliance with state and local regulations pertaining to environmental health, this may include taking product samples and forwarding for testing. Secures water samples, investigates nuisance complaints such as animal bites and other duties related to environmental health; reviews and approves onsite sewage disposal site plans, conducts soil evaluations, designs and approves locations, conducts inspections of conventional, modified and experimental treatment systems, provides investigations & gathers evidence for enforcement of onsite sewage laws; request assistance from supervisors in situations beyond his/her scope of training and experience. Interpret reports generated by the Environmental Health Management Information System (EHMIS)/Graphical Users Interface (GUI) system. Analyzes and interprets data regarding test results, inspections results, etc. and presents results to appropriate types of audiences.
  • Assist with developing, updating and maintaining public health emergency preparedness plans and standard operating procedures; coordinate with existing preparedness staff to ensure plans align with local and state requirements and guidance; help identify training needs for staff related to emergency preparedness; assist in planning, delivering, and evaluating trainings, drills and exercises; work with existing preparedness staff to build and maintain partnerships with community organizations, healthcare providers, schools, and emergency management agencies; participate in local, regional, and state preparedness meetings as assigned.

Minimum Education, Training or Experience: Bachelor’s degree from a college or university with a minor or twenty-four (24) semester hours in environmental health, biological or physical science or registration as a Kentucky Environmental Specialist/Sanitarian under KRS 223.

Special Requirements: Must possess and maintain a valid driver’s license with up-to-date vehicle insurance.

Note: an individual upon employment must become registered under the provisions of KRS 223 to remain a permanent employee per Administrative Regulations 902KAR 8:080.
